Lancaster Storms Past Patriots 9-7

May3rdGRAPHICLancaster, PA – The Lancaster Barnstormers (5-3) rallied past the Somerset Patriots (6-2) 9-7 Saturday night from Clipper Magazine Stadium. The two squads have split the first two games of this four game wrap around weekend series.

In the bottom of the first inning Lancaster plated a pair of runs on a RBI infield single by designated hitter Austin Gallagher and a throwing error by pitcher Zach Kroenke as the Stormers took an early 2-0 advantage.

In the top of the second inning Somerset sent eight men to the plate and scored five runs. Catcher Adam Donachie drew a bases loaded walk. Center fielder Jonny Tucker recorded a RBI sacrifice fly and second baseman Nate Spears clubbed a go ahead three run home run (2) to right field to make the score 5-2 in favor of the Patriots.

Lancaster scored two runs in the bottom of the fourth inning cutting the deficit to 5-4. Shortstop Lance Zawadski tallied a RBI sacrifice fly while center fielder Blake Gailen smacked a RBI single.

Somerset tacked on a run in the top of the fifth frame as third baseman Corey Smith ripped a RBI single upping the lead to 6-4.

The Barnstormers evened the score at 6-6 when right fielder Greg Golson hit a two RBI single in the bottom of the fifth frame.

In the ensuing half inning Donachie stroked a go ahead RBI single to put the Patriots back in front at 7-6.

Lancaster later took a 9-7 lead which they would not relinquish. In the bottom of the seventh inning second baseman Casey Frawley launched a two RBI double while first baseman Bobby Kielty notched a RBI double of his own.

Shunsuke Watanabe (1-0) earned the win in relief. Derell McCall (1-1) suffered the loss in relief. Pete Andrelczyk notched his second save of the year pitching a scoreless ninth inning.
